Challenging the Norms of Meditation

Traditional wisdom often advises practitioners to empty their minds and focus solely on their breath. While this method works for many, it can leave others feeling frustrated, as thoughts inevitably intrude. I propose that we shift this perspective. What if instead of fighting our thoughts, we could invite them in and observe them? Mindfulness meditation encourages this approach—allowing each thought to drift by like a leaf on a stream rather than battling against a current. This shift in mindset not only fosters a more inclusive environment for all forms of meditation but also promotes a sense of agency and control over our thoughts.

The Interdisciplinary Approach to Meditation

Combining insights from psychology, philosophy, and even technology can enrich our experience of meditation.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), for example, teaches us to challenge distorted thinking; when paired with meditation, it can help us better understand our thought patterns. Philosophers like Alan Watts remind us to embrace the impermanence of life, which can enhance our meditation practices by encouraging us to let go of expectations. Additionally, modern technologies such as meditation apps or guided breathing techniques can serve as invaluable tools to extend the reach of meditation to those who may otherwise shy away from it due to unfamiliarity.

Practical Steps to Incorporate Meditation into Daily Life

Embarking on the journey of meditation need not be daunting. Here are some practical steps to consider:

  • Start Small:
    Begin with just five minutes a day. Gradually increase the duration as you become more comfortable.
  • Create a Dedicated Space:
    Designate a corner in your home as your meditation sanctuary. This physical space will serve as a trigger for your mind to enter a state of relaxation.
  • Use Guided Meditations:
    Apps like Headspace or Calm offer guided sessions that can help you navigate the initial learning curve.
  • Explore Different Techniques:
    Experiment with various methods such as visualization, loving-kindness meditation, or body scans to discover what resonates best with you.
  • Join a Community:
    Engage in local or online meditation groups to learn from others and stay motivated on your journey.
